The Homestead Exemption is a program designed throughout the state of South Carolina for taxpayers who are 65 years old or older, totally and permanently disabled, or legally blind. The Homestead exemption takes care of up to the first $50,000 of the fair market value of the taxpayers dwelling/home.

County Council gave 1st Reading at their meeting on October 2, 2023, and held the first of two public hearings at their meeting on November …The high mileage chart is determined by the South Carolina Department of Revenue. Taxpayers may appeal the appraised value of a vehicle for high mileage if the vehicle averages over 15,000 miles, annually, based on the age of the vehicle (total miles divided by age of vehicle). The lawsuit was filed in 2014 ...The statewide Sales & Use Tax rate is six percent (6%). Counties may impose an additional one percent (1%) local sales tax if voters in that county approve the tax. Generally, all retail sales are subject to the Sales Tax. Dorchester County residents have paid a one-cent sales tax since 2005. That extra penny from every dollar funds road work. Council Chairman Bill Hearn says the penny tax has created millions of dollars for major projects. “Some of the projects people would remember would be Dorchester Road and Highway 78, which is still in process.Due to voter approval of the one-cent sales tax, the Dorchester County Sales Tax Transportation Authority (DCTA) implemented a program for infrastructure improvement projects. Please review your paper Dorchester County EMS bill and have your account number available prior to …, Applied on a per employee basis, Dorchester County currently attributes $1,500 per new employee to the company’s corporate income tax liability in South Carolina. By creating new jobs in Dorchester County, companies may earn annual credits that can be used for five years and offset state corporate income tax liability by up to 50%., H3243) took effect on August 1, 2019.
